Minamata disease (medicine)


Minamata disease


A neurologic disorder caused by methyl mercury intoxication; first described in the inhabitants of Minamata Bay, Japan, resulting from their eating fish contaminated with mercury industrial waste. Characterised by peripheral sensory loss, tremors, dysarthria, ataxia, and both hearing and visual loss.


Silvana' s sticky wings (recipes)








Serves 6



Preparation time

1-2 hours



Cooking time

10 to 30 mins

















Ingredients



1 orange, grated rind and juice only1 tbsp dark muscovado sugar1 tbsp clear honey1 tsp cayenne1 tsp ground ginger¼ tsp salt12 large chicken wings



Method



1. Place the orange rind and juice in a large bowl and stir in the sugar, honey, cayenne, ginger and salt. 2. Add the wings, cover and chill for an hour or two, turning from time to time.3. Set on a rack and roast at 200C/400F/Gas 6 for 25 minutes or barbecue until cooked through and nicely browned.
